The FNS30315 Certificate III in Accounts Administration course provides students the skills and knowledge to work effectively within the financial services and accounting industries and is ideal for entry level employmentin the financial services industry and for those seeking formal recognition of existing skills. This course contains 11 units (7 core and 4 electives) and covers the following themes;
  • Accounting Principles and Practice
  • Business and Technology
  • Professional Practice and Personal Development
There are no formal entry requirements for FNS40215 Certificate III in Accounts Administration, however, you should have;
  • Completed at least Year 10 from an Australian secondary school or overseas equivalent
    OR
    Proof of equivalent competency in core skills to a level appropriate for the course being applied for
  • Successful completion of a Language, Literacy and Numeracy (LLN) Assessment
  • Computer Literacy (recommended but not compulsory)

Units
Core Units
  1. FNSACC301 Process Financial Transactions and Extract Interim Reports
  2. FNSACC302 Administer Subsidiary Accounts and Ledgers
  3. FNSACC303 Perform Financial Calculations
  4. BSBITU306 Design and Produce Business Documents
  5. BSBWRT301 Write Simple Documents
  6. FNSINC301 Work Effectively in the Financial Services Industry
  7. BSBWHS201 Contribute to Health and Safety of Self and Others
Elective Units
  1. FNSINC401 Apply Principles of Professional Practice in a Financial Service Industry
  2. BSBCUS301 Deliver and Monitor a Service to Customers
  3. FNSBKG401 Develop and Implement Policies and Procedures Relevant to Bookkeeping Activities
  4. BSBWOR301 Organise Personal Work Priorities and Development
